The AHCA Clinical Practice Committee has developed and launched a new resource for members, Opioid Use: What Do We Do and How? 

The use of opioid medications to manage chronic pain is complex and challenging, especially in long term care and post-acute settings. As the care of individuals with chronic pain in these settings increases, it is imperative to understand concerns, challenges and opportunities surrounding this issue. This program focuses on the foundation of pain management and how optimal pain management can help prevent opioid abuse. 

This multi-part video series is available on ahcancalED. It offers “Steps to Opioid Reduction,” which covers steps by which any center can safely and effectively attempt to reduce opioids in individuals who are on opioids as well as “Appropriate and Safe Use of Opioids As Part of Effective Pain Management,” which covers key processes and practices of pain management including, but not limited to, the use of opioids in that context.
